A Google Business Profile (previously Google My Enterprise) is a free business itemizing with information about what you are promoting. It allows you to supply particulars like your location, companies, merchandise, and images. Then, Google will list it in local search outcomes. Optimizing your business Profile is one among crucial local SEO duties, based on Google. Which suggests you need a Google Business Profile if you'd like to stand any likelihood of rating effectively for native searches. NAP citations are places that mention your identify, tackle, and telephone quantity (NAP) on-line. They often appear on enterprise directories and social media profiles. NAP citations are vital because Google could use them to confirm that your small business info is correct. And that what you say about your enterprise on-line is true.

A slightly lesser-identified function of Google My Business is Google Posts. With this characteristic, you may publish images, textual content, news, and information concerning a specific occasion. Google posts may help increase your relevance and rankings, permitting potential shoppers to find you extra readily when trying to find a services or products your small business affords. Add Google Submit efforts to your common social media posting schedule to keep it fresh and related.
